It wasn’t the best of starts for African teams but Franck Kessie was the star of the day as the football event in the summer Olympics kicked off on Thursday.
The AC Milan midfielder was the hero of the day as helped his country to a winning start in what was a day of mixed results for African teams in the football event at Tokyo2020.
Ivory Coast survived a scare to defeat Saudi Arabia 2-1 thanks to an own goal and a beautiful second half goal from Kessie.
Saudi was the better team, but the Ivorina rode their lucky all through the game to seal the win, but were not so lucky when Aboubacar Doumbia came on from the bench on 90 minutes only to be sent off in added time following an altercation with Saudi players.
Elsewhere, Egypt held Spain to a goalless draw while South Africa narrowly lost 1-0 to Japan in the final game of the day for African teams.
Real Madrid youngster Takefusa Kubo scored the all-important winner for the Japanese youngsters late on in the second half.
On Sunday, the CIV will play Group D leaders Brasil, Egypt take on Argentina in Group C while the Rainbow nation, South Africa have their hands full against fellow Group A side and European giants France, who suffered a humiliating 4-1 loss to Mexico in their opener.
